草庐IT

php - 自定义帖子类型事件菜单项

我创建了一个名为“团队”的自定义帖子类型,并将存档页面的链接添加到WP菜单。一旦用户点击它,他就会看到所有团队成员,并且当前页面在菜单中突出显示。但是当我点击个别团队成员时,他的页面打开并且菜单中的“团队”不再突出显示,它应该是。这是打开团队页面时的显示方式:Team这是我打开个人成员(member)页面时在菜单中看到的内容:Team因为我不是PHP开发人员,所以我不知道如何让它工作,任何建议将不胜感激:) 最佳答案 我从here中获取并编辑了这个对我有用的东西.我有“盆景”的地方将其更改为您的自定义帖子类型。在我放置“menu-i

php - 如何在 drupal 7 中获取某个父项下的所有菜单项?

我目前正在开发一个模块,该模块通过url路径查找父菜单项,然后通过查找顶级父项来显示该相关菜单的当前树结构,最重要的是仅显示该菜单项和该菜单中的子菜单。一个简单的解决方案是使用一个foreach循环遍历所有项目或一个以所有项目为键的数组。path='/system/menu/submenu';parent='system';output=parent+parentsubmenus.“自定义菜单”中的所有菜单项:-System-Menuwrapper-SubMenu1A-SubMenu2A-SubMenu3A-Main-SubMenu1B-SubMenu2B-SubChildMenu3B

php - Joomla 3.3 - 通过插件向所有菜单项添加自定义字段 - 参数未保存

我在向com_menus-项目View添加自定义字段时遇到问题。教程:(参见:http://docs.joomla.org/Adding_custom_fields_to_core_components_using_a_plugin)教程效果很好(com_contact),但是当我想覆盖菜单项View时:参数未保存!!!下面是我用来确定添加自定义表单的组件和View的代码。classplgContentPluginNameextendsJPlugin{functiononContentPrepareForm($form,$data){$app=JFactory::getApplicat

php - 使用简单项目的 SKU/ID 以编程方式在 Magento 中添加 bundle 产品

我在Magento中有一些简单的目录产品,所以我有它们的SKU和ID。现在我想使用bundle项目的数组元素“bundle_options”和“bundle_selections”创建bundle产品,MagentoAdmin编码在其观察者类中使用这些元素。在Observer类中,还有两个函数“setBundleOptionsData()”和“setBundleSelectionsData()”的方法调用,我无法找到它们任何函数定义。请任何专业的帖子在这里,因为我需要一些正确的方法来做这件事。如果需要,覆盖模块或使用事件,我会做,但我需要真正专业的帮助。提前致谢。编辑:-关于上面提到的

php - 获取 Joomla 菜单项的 "Alias"字段

有没有办法从mod_mainmenu模块获取Joomla1.5中主菜单项的别名字段?我知道您可以使用以下代码访问菜单:$menu=JSite::getMenu();我需要使用别名字段来保存菜单项的副标题。是否可以从mod_mainmenu中的modMainMenuXMLCallback()函数获取它?谢谢。 最佳答案 $menu=JSite::getMenu();$alias=$menu->getItem($id)->alias;//ifyouhaveidofmenu$menu=JSite::getMenu();$alias=$me

php - Magento Admin::删除特定角色/用户的菜单项

我想从特定用户角色的管理菜单中删除一个菜单项。我见过其他人通过创建虚拟覆盖来做到这一点,但这些不是基于角色。我想在不使用其中一个.xml文件的情况下执行此操作。例如,有没有办法做到这一点;__construct()还是prepareLayout?编辑:我必须补充一点,我想禁用的部分是CMS中的管理层次结构项。我知道我可以只为用户角色禁用层次结构,但我需要它来保存CMS页面。 最佳答案 我用自己的block扩展了Mage_Adminhtml_Block_Page_Menu。我复制了函数“_buildMenuArray()”就在我返回菜

mysql - 如何在 phpmyadmin 上制作复合主键

如何在phpmyadmin上制作复合主键。这样学生ID是年份和卷号的组合。sid=112132,2011年的11和2132是卷号??任何人都可以帮助.. 最佳答案 如果表已经创建:在“结构”Pane中,选中要包含在主键中的所有字段名称左侧的复选框。(例如,在订单项表中,您可以检查“订单ID”和“订单项号”。)然后在字段名称下方的“Withselected:”操作列表中单击“Primary”。您现在还可以在创建表时定义键,如@amila的回答中所述 关于mysql-如何在phpmyadmi

mysql - 如何在 phpmyadmin 上制作复合主键

如何在phpmyadmin上制作复合主键。这样学生ID是年份和卷号的组合。sid=112132,2011年的11和2132是卷号??任何人都可以帮助.. 最佳答案 如果表已经创建:在“结构”Pane中,选中要包含在主键中的所有字段名称左侧的复选框。(例如,在订单项表中,您可以检查“订单ID”和“订单项号”。)然后在字段名称下方的“Withselected:”操作列表中单击“Primary”。您现在还可以在创建表时定义键,如@amila的回答中所述 关于mysql-如何在phpmyadmi

android - 如何更改上下文菜单项的颜色

我无法将上下文菜单栏上的项目颜色更改为白色。酒吧看起来像这样-我有一个扩展AppCompatActivity的Activity。我正在使用带有Theme.AppCompat.Light.NoActionBar主题的工具栏。style.xml如下所示:@style/MyActionBartruetruetrue@style/ThemeOverlay.AppCompat.Light@style/LStyled.ActionMode@android:color/white@android:color/white@android:color/white@color/edit_text_bord

android - 更改由 xml 布局制作的工具栏菜单上的菜单项

所以我的应用程序中有这个工具栏,我想根据用户是否登录显示不同的菜单项。当用户登录或注销时,我想更新我的布局,现在是工具栏菜单来表示更改。但出于某种原因,我的菜单项根本没有被删除,所有菜单项始终可见,无论登录状态如何。我的菜单项:第一个菜单项应该只对已登录的用户可见。而且我想这是不言自明的,但我只希望其中一个登录/注销按钮根据登录状态可见。我的Java代码:protectedvoidinitializeToolbar(){myToolbar=(Toolbar)findViewById(R.id.my_toolbar);menu=myToolbar.getMenu();resetToolb